Background
The oligosaccharide is also called oligose, and is polymerized by 2-10 same or different monosaccharides through glycosidic bonds. The oligosaccharide has the characteristics of saccharide, can be directly used as food ingredients, and has physiological functions of promoting the proliferation of human bifidobacteria and the like.
When the oligosaccharide is prepared, the most common preparation method is enzyme method production, the enzyme method production generally needs to rapidly stir raw materials and enzyme together, and needs to heat to enable the enzyme to be in the optimal state, and the current equipment causes uneven mixing of the raw materials due to uneven heat conduction and stirring, thereby influencing the quality of products at the later stage.

The working principle is as follows: when the raw material rapid mixing preheating device for oligosaccharide production is used, the motor 5 and the electric heating wire 13 are communicated, the stirring shaft 6 drives the double-helix stirring blade 7 to rotate, the raw material for oligosaccharide production is added from the feed end of the feed pipe 3, the heat generated by the electric heating wire 13 is transferred to the stirring barrel 1, and is transmitted into the raw materials through the stirring barrel 1, the raw materials are stirred from inside to outside and from left to right through the unique design of the double-helix stirring blade 7, so that the raw materials are stirred and heat conduction is more uniform, then the arc-shaped bottom plate 14 is drawn out, the uniformly stirred raw materials are discharged from the discharge pipe 8, the bolt on the seal plate 4 is removed, the motor 5 is pulled outwards, thereby can take out double helix stirring vane 7 to conveniently wash inside, through using this oligosaccharide production to use raw materials flash mixed preheating device, make the heat conduction of raw materials and stir more even, thereby reach the purpose that promotes the product quality.
